The Mechanics of Cleaning House: A Guide To Unfollowing Every Last One
So, how does one embark on this digital decluttering journey? Here are the basic steps:
- Identify the sources of digital clutter: social media, email, messaging apps, and online subscriptions.
- Take a holistic approach: consider how each online activity affects your mental and emotional state.
- Start small: begin with one platform or activity and work your way through each area of digital clutter.
- Categorize and prioritize: separate essential accounts from unnecessary ones and prioritize your online relationships.
- Set boundaries: establish rules for your digital interactions, such as limiting screen time or avoiding certain topics.

How Cleaning House: A Guide To Unfollowing Every Last One Affects Different Users
Not everyone's experience with digital clutter is the same, and the impact of cleaning house can vary from person to person. Some users may experience:
- Reduced stress and anxiety: by eliminating sources of digital toxicity, individuals can cultivate a more peaceful online environment.
- Improved mental health: by controlling their digital intake and engagement, users can promote a healthier relationship with technology.
- Enhanced productivity: by minimizing distractions and focusing on essential online interactions, individuals can boost their productivity and efficiency.
- Increased self-awareness: through the process of digital decluttering, users can gain a deeper understanding of their online habits and preferences.
